Concrete raising services are designed to restore the levelness and stability of uneven or sunken concrete slabs. This process typically involves lifting and leveling existing concrete surfaces such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ors without the need for complete removal and replacement. Skilled service providers use specialized techniques and equipment to lift the concrete back into its proper position, helping to improve safety and appearance while extending the lifespan of the surface.
One of the primary issues addressed by concrete raising is uneven or settled slabs that create tripping hazards or impede normal use of outdoor and indoor spaces. When concrete shifts or sinks over time due to soil erosion, freeze-thaw cycles, or poor initial installation, it can lead to cracks, uneven surfaces, and potential damage to adjacent structures. Concrete raising offers a cost-effective alternative to replacement, providing a quick solution to restore the integrity of the existing concrete without extensive demolition or construction work.

Cost Range - Concrete raising services typically cost between $500 and $2,000 per slab, depending on size and condition. Larger or more complex projects may reach higher amounts, with some jobs costing around $2,500. Variations depend on the extent of the settling and local rates.
Factors Influencing Cost - The price for concrete raising can vary based on the size of the area and the severity of the settlement. Smaller driveways might be on the lower end, around $500, while extensive commercial slabs could exceed $2,000. Additional work like crack repair may also impact the overall cost.
Average Pricing - Typically, homeowners in Shelby, OH, can expect to pay between $700 and $1,500 for residential concrete raising. Prices fluctuate with project complexity, location, and contractor rates. Getting multiple estimates can help determine the most accurate cost for specific needs.
Cost Considerations - Costs for concrete raising are generally lower than replacement, offering savings especially for minor settling issues. The overall expense depends on factors like access, the number of slabs, and the type of raising method used. Local service providers can provide detailed quotes based on individual proj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
Concrete Lifting services involve raising sunken or uneven concrete slabs to restore their original position and levelness. Local pros provide solutions for driveways, sidewalks, and patios affected by ground settling.
Slab Jacking is a method used to lift and stabilize concrete surfaces by injecting a grout beneath the slab. This service is often sought for correcting uneven walkways and garage floors.
Mud Jacking involves using a mixture of soil and cement to lift and level concrete slabs. Contractors in Shelby and nearby areas offer this technique to address sinking concrete structures.
Polyurethane Foam Raising utilizes high-density foam to lift and support concrete surfaces efficiently. Local service providers use this approach for quick and minimally invasive repairs.
Concrete Leveling services focus on restoring proper slope and alignment to prevent tripping hazards and improve surface stability. Professionals can assess and elevate uneven concrete in various applications.
Foundation Stabilization services may include raising and supporting concrete foundations that have shifted or settled over time. Experts provide solutions to improve structural integrity and safety.
